ASTM A229 Spring Steel vs. AISI 410 Stainless Steel

Both ASTM A229 spring steel and AISI 410 stainless steel are iron alloys. They have 87%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 31 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is ASTM A229 spring steel and the bottom bar is AISI 410 stainless steel.
